Output 323d1d3a760603d3a87b69986af379a8ac3c0ce33026a8a9ab4849df6101519d:131

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85643a3e6aae330d2eed61374ae8d3a6ebd497fa0dde8c285f26235b5b2f0e7a
address
bc1ps4jr50n24ces6thdvym546xn5m4af9l6ph0gc2zlyc34kke0peaqfvrsjx
transaction
323d1d3a760603d3a87b69986af379a8ac3c0ce33026a8a9ab4849df6101519d
spent
true